Naomi Wolf, the author of "The Beauty Myth" and "Fire With Fire" explores and celebrates female sexuality, and shows how culture tries to shape and confine women's desire. Drawing fantasy, she demonstrates that female sexuality is wilder, more demanding and more powerful than our cultures dare to accept, and dispels men's severely flawed notions of what women want. Synopsis
Explores and celebrates the phenomenon of female sexuality - empirically, imaginatively, anatomically and personally. Following a group of four girls (including her younger self) as they come of age in the 70s, Wolfe shows how our culture tries to shape and confine women's desire.
